
Mariners Split Doubleheader, Lose Series
August 2, 2014 - Appalachian League (ApL)
Pulaski Mariners News Release
The Pulaski Mariners (22-19) split Saturday's doubleheader with the Danville Braves (25-15). Pulaski fell in game one 2-1 and took the finale with a 1-0 shutout.
Luis Pina (1-1, 4.25 ERA) made his first start of the season during the first game. The lefthander lasted only three innings and surrendered both runs on five hits. Both of Danville's runs came in the third inning.
Pulaski scored their lone run in the top of the first inning. Wayne Taylor drove home Estarlyn Morales with a single into left.
Zack Littell (4-4, 5.70 ERA) led the Mariners to victory in the closing game of the series. Littell threw five innings of shutout ball and fanned seven Braves while allowing five hits.
Morales provided the only offense of game two with a solo homerun in the second inning-his fourth homer of the year.
Trey Cochran-Gill (3-0, 0.00 ERA) closed out the game by pitching the final two innings en route to his seventh save.
The Mariners return home to Calfee Park for a two-series home stand. Pulaski plays three games against the Kingsport Mets (20-22) then face the Greeneville Astros (23-20) following a day off.
